Installation Tips for a Secure 48-Inch Fence
- Set posts 8–10 ft apart; use T-posts or wood posts for maximum rigidity.
- Fasten the top edge first, then stretch the bottom tight to reduce sagging.
- Use outdoor-rated wire clips, staples, or zip ties at every post.
- For gates, use a heavier frame and brace the connection points.
